Check the Plumbing
Measure the center-to-center dimension between the hot and cold water pipes on the top of the water heater and try to ensure the new heater has the same dimensions. That will make the plumbing job a bit easier. Take a look at the plumbing connecting to the old water heater. Make sure you have a union in the line if you have a water heater, and make sure there are a water shutoff for the cold water inlet pipe and a union connector for the hot water outlet pipe. Heater, then install the cold water shut off valve, and / or union or hot water pipe union.
